CalPERS’ public and private equity reset shapes performance

CalPERS is continuing to reap the benefits of a sweeping overhaul of its public and private equity programs, with the two asset classes, which are the biggest components in the portfolio, powering a 14.8 per cent return for the $637 billion fund in the last reporting period.

Why MFS no longer pays on short-term results

If managers want to reinforce their long-term investor bona fides they should adopt appropriate time horizons for investments they make, disclose more about asset holding duration, and reconsider paying themselves based on short-term results. Only then will the interests of asset owners and the managers they employ be truly aligned.

‘Golden age of private credit’ comes with idiosyncratic risks: Pictet

Pictet private debt head Andreas Klein says “mainstream” private credit investments have run their course as buyout activity decreases and global regulators up their oversight. Instead, investors should consider “micro-niches”, but he warns these emerging corners of the market come with hidden and unique risks.
